How Neptune Hosting Works: Step-by-Step

Setting up hosting with Neptune is generally a straightforward process. Below, you’ll find helpful steps:

1. Assess Your Needs

  • Personal site or blog? Shared hosting may be enough.
  • Business store, membership site, or high-traffic blog? Consider VPS or managed hosting.
  • Expecting rapid growth? Ask about cloud or enterprise plans.

2. Choose a Hosting Plan

Typical offerings might include:

  • Shared Hosting (for beginners and small sites)
  • VPS Hosting (for more control and power)
  • Managed Hosting (hands-off, ideal for non-technical users)
  • Dedicated Hosting (for large businesses or specialized applications)

3. Register or Transfer a Domain

  • Buy a new domain or transfer an existing one.
  • Set up DNS records to point your domain to your Neptune Hosting server.

4. Set Up Your Website

  • Use a website builder, one-click installer (for WordPress, Joomla, etc.), or upload your site manually.
  • Set up email accounts, SSL certificates, and install any required software.

5. Monitor and Maintain

  • Use the hosting dashboard for monitoring.
  • Set up scheduled backups.
  • Contact support as needed for troubleshooting.
  • Watch site traffic and performance for potential upgrades.

Practical Tips and Best Practices

Making the most of your Neptune Hosting experience is about more than just choosing a plan. Here’s how to ensure success:

1. Regularly Update Passwords and Security Settings

  • Use complex passwords for your hosting control panel and email accounts.
  • Enable two-factor authentication if offered.

2. Take Advantage of Automated Backups

  • Double-check that backups are running.
  • Download copies occasionally for safekeeping.

3. Use Support Wisely

  • Don’t hesitate to reach out if you encounter obstacles or server issues.
  • Keep tickets clear and provide details for faster help.

4. Watch for Resource Usage

  • Monitor site stats in your hosting dashboard.
  • Upgrade before you hit limits to avoid downtime.

5. Optimize Your Website

  • Use caching plugins or built-in tools for faster load times.
  • Compress images and use modern code.

6. Choose the Right Plan for Growth

  • It’s tempting to save money with the smallest plan, but factor in expected traffic.
  • Ask Neptune’s staff for recommendations if you’re unsure.
